  • Patent number: 8787325
    Abstract: Time frames (TFs) are allocated for performance of transactions of a low latency data stream (LLDS) and a best effort data stream (BEDS) in Bluetooth®-like equipment, wherein payload carrying packets of the different data streams are equal in size, each occupying multiple TFs. An overrule mechanism enables uncompleted transactions of one data stream to continue as needed into TFs allocated to another data stream. Every TF within an allocation window (AW) is individually allocated to the LLDS or the BEDS, and plural TFs immediately following the AW form a guard space between adjacent AWs, the guard space being allocated to neither the LLDDS or the BEDS. Configuration of the AW and of the guard space guarantees the LLDS a first opportunity to transmit a payload carrying packet and continued opportunities to retransmit the packet until successful, after which the BEDS is given an opportunity for transmission and possible retransmissions.

  • Patent number: 7693485
    Abstract: A Bluetooth master unit polls a slave unit to enable the slave to resynchronize to the master, by sending POLL packets with sufficient frequency to maintain a connection to the slave, and in the intervals between such packets, sending NULL packets with sufficient frequency to maintain synchronization of the slave. By replacing some POLL packets with NULL packets, since the slave does not have to respond to a NULL packet, it can save some power, and there is reduced interference on other piconets. The frequency of the remaining POLL packets is set according to a Link Supervision Timeout (to avoid having this timer expire and thus keep the Bluetooth Link to the slave alive) and according to the time since the master received the last packet from the slave.

  • Patent number: 7564832
    Abstract: A Bluetooth master radio frequency unit addresses a slave radio frequency unit, to enable the slave to resynchronize to the master, by sending poll packets or null packets, the master being arranged to send sufficient null packets to enable the slave to resynchronize, before sending a poll packet, to determine whether the slave has resynchronized. This approach can provide the slave with the same number of synchronization packets as in the simpler algorithms, while allowing the slave to preserve more (transmit) power and still allowing the master to detect whether the slave has resynchronized or not (and thus to update a Link Supervision Timer for example). Notably this is also suitable for use in prescheduling implementations.
